在本文中,Android 文件传输无法在 Mac 上使用的问题及解决方法介绍一下。
最近的 macOS(Ventura / Sonoma 或更高版本)和 Pixel 系列很可能会出现这种情况,因此如果您遇到问题,请尝试一下。
关于Android File Transfer无法识别的问题
如果您想通过 USB 连接 Android 和 Mac 来传输文件,请使用专用软件。
安卓文件传输是必须的。
相关文章 如何使用 Android 文件传输
但是,即使您按照正确的步骤操作,也可能会出现以下消息并且连接可能会失败。
端末に接続できませんでした 端末を再接続または再起動してください。

无法连接到设备
这是将三种 Android 型号(Xperia/Galaxy/Pixel)连接到两台具有不同操作系统版本的 Mac 的结果。
从网上的评论来看,这个问题很可能是在最近的 macOS(Ventura/Sonoma 或更高版本)和 Pixel 系列的组合中出现的。
作为解决方案,请先尝试以下方法。
- 重启并重新连接 Android 或 Mac
- 仔细检查 Android 端的 USB 设置是否设置为“文件传输”。
- 关闭Mac端运行的基于云的服务(Google Drive、Dropbox等)
如果问题仍然没有改善,请使用其他软件。
开放MTP推荐。
下面我将解释如何使用它。
开放MTP下载。
Mac 版有两种,下载链接也不同。
请检查哪一种适用于您的 Mac。
- 采用 Apple 芯片的 Mac
- 配备英特尔处理器的 Mac

下载 OpenMTP
Apple Silicon 已从 2020 年底发布的部分型号开始引入。
菜单关于这款 Mac从显示的内容就可以看出。
▼采用 Apple 芯片的 Mac

对于Apple Silicon,会显示芯片名称。
▼搭载Intel处理器的Mac

如果是 Intel,则显示处理器名称。
解压缩下载的 .dmg 文件并将其拖放到您的应用程序文件夹中。

拖放到应用程序文件夹。
启动 OpenMTP。
如果出现以下信息,请选择右键菜单打开选择将其打开。
“OpenMTP”は、開発元を検証できないため開けません。
相关文章 如何在 Mac 上修复“无法打开,因为无法验证开发者”

由于无法验证开发者,因此无法打开该文件。

从右键菜单打开

打开
接下来,使用 USB 线连接您的智能手机和 Mac。
此时,请解锁您的智能手机屏幕。
Android 端会显示一条通知,点击该通知并将 USB 连接用途切换为“文件传输”。

以 Pixel 7a 为例。点击 USB 连接通知

从“仅充电”(左)切换到“文件传输”(右)。
对于某些型号,会显示诸如“您想要允许访问吗?”之类的消息。可能会出现。
如果您允许,USB 连接使用“文件传输”将自动打开。

以 Xperia 10 II 为例。通过 USB 连接时,将出现一条请求访问权限的消息。
现在
智能手机已被 OpenMTP 识别。
Mac 的内部存储将显示在屏幕左侧,Android 的内部存储将显示在右侧。

左侧为 Mac,右侧为 Android 内部存储。
如果无法正确识别并出现以下屏幕,请按照提供的说明进行操作。

无法识别时的屏幕。尝试右侧显示的内容。
下面是简单的日文翻译。
- 关闭 Google Drive、Android 文件传输、Dropbox、OneDrive、预览
- 解锁安卓屏幕锁
- 将Android端的USB设置切换为“文件传输”
- 某些型号(Galaxy/Xperia...等)允许屏幕上显示“访问设备数据”。
尝试完这两种方法后,请不要忘记单击 OpenMTP 屏幕上的“刷新”图标。

点击红框中的刷新图标
顺便说一句,在我的环境中,
预览应用程序似乎做错了什么,当我关闭它时,我能够识别Android。
OpenMTP 允许各种文件操作。
从根本上
您可以使用 Android 文件传输执行相同的操作。
- 在 Mac 和 Android 之间传输文件
- 在 Android 中删除文件/创建文件夹
- 操作插入Android的SD卡
您可以使用拖放功能在 Mac 和 Android 之间移动文件。
对于Android的文件夹结构来说,图片和视频通常存放在“DCIM”、“Pictures”和“Movies”中,下载的文件存放在“Download”中。
相关文章关于Android文件夹结构
〆:使用 OpenMTP 管理文件!
多于,Android文件传输无法在Mac上使用的原因!解决OpenMTP无法连接Pixel设备的问题这就是解释。
尽管Android File Transfer是Google的官方软件,但我们很可能无法指望未来有任何改进。
如果您经常通过 USB 连接 Mac 和 Android,
请考虑切换到 OpenMTP。
